Popular Tractor Models in Pakistan
Pakistan’s farms use many tractor models from top makers. The Massey Ferguson 240, New Holland TD 85, and John Deere 6405 are favorites. They are known for being tough, efficient, and good on fuel, fitting Pakistan’s farming needs well.
- Massey Ferguson 240: Known for its reliability and ease of maintenance.
- New Holland TD 85: Praised for its power and fuel efficiency.
- John Deere 6405: Recognized for its advanced technology and comfort.

Rotavators: Comprehensive Soil Preparation Tools
In modern agriculture, rotavators are key for land preparation. They efficiently till and condition the soil. These tools are vital for farmers to enhance soil quality and get it ready for planting.
Benefits of Rotavators for Land Preparation
Rotavators improve soil aeration and reduce compaction. They also help control weeds. By breaking up the soil, they allow for better water and root growth, leading to healthier crops.
Using rotavators makes land preparation easier. It reduces the need for multiple passes with different tools. This saves time and lowers farming costs.
Weed Control and Soil Mixing Applications
Rotavators are great for weed control. They uproot weeds and mix them into the soil. This method is better for the environment and saves money on herbicides.
They also mix soil amendments like fertilizers and organic matter into the soil. This ensures nutrients are spread evenly, helping crops grow well.

Irrigation Systems: Water Management for Sustainable Farming
Water management is key in sustainable farming. Irrigation systems play a big role here. They make sure crops get the right water at the right time. This boosts yields and cuts down on waste.
Drip Irrigation: Water Conservation Technology
Drip irrigation is a top choice for saving water. It sends water straight to the roots, cutting down on evaporation and runoff. It’s especially good in places like Pakistan, where water is scarce.
Benefits of Drip Irrigation: It can save up to 50% of water compared to old methods. It also helps crops grow better by keeping the soil moist.
Sprinkler Systems: Uniform Water Distribution
Sprinkler systems spread water evenly, like rain. This is great for crops that need steady moisture to grow well.
Advantages of Sprinkler Systems: They work well for many crops, from wheat to veggies. They can also adjust to the field’s shape.
Smart Irrigation Controls for Pakistani Farms
Smart irrigation uses sensors and data to save water. It checks soil moisture, weather, and what crops need. Then, it changes the water schedule as needed.

Balers and Post-Harvest Equipment: Maximizing Crop Value
Balers and post-harvest equipment are key tools for farmers today. They help farmers get the most value from their crops in a competitive market. Modern baling technology and equipment have changed farming, making crops better, reducing waste, and boosting profits.
Modern Baling Technology for Hay and Straw
Modern baling tech has made hay and straw better by turning them into neat bales. This saves space and makes them easier to handle. Balers come in round and square types, each suited for different farming needs.
Essential Post-Harvest Tools for Quality Produce
Post-harvest tools are key for keeping produce quality high. Graders, cleaners, and dryers are crucial for meeting market standards.
Graders and Sorters
Graders and sorters sort produce by size and quality. This helps farmers get better prices by selling only the best.
Cleaners and Dryers
Cleaners get rid of dirt, and dryers lower moisture to stop spoilage. These tools are vital for keeping crops good during storage and transport.
